Meet our team!🌱
Introducing Melanie, owner of Mend.
“I came to a career in bodywork following my studies in dance at the University of Oregon where I earned my Bachelors of Science degree. My intense exploration of movement, breath, collaboration, and expression brought forward a mind body connection in my everyday experience in and out of the dance studio. I found that through massage I am able to guide others to this place of awareness, acceptance, and constant flow of shifting change that occurs within us all.
I appreciate focused work on acute and chronic injuries and affected structures as well as deeply healing relaxation massage. As a working LMT since 2007 with experience in both Spa and medical settings, I found a balance between the two that is ensures a truly satisfying wellness experience.”
•Why did you want to open your own practice?!
“I started Mend as a solo practice in 2016 and it slowly and organically grew to what you experience today. My vision is a community wellness center with a unique, caring and supportive client focus. Where every person who walks through our doors receives care that is tailored to their individual needs at the time. You aren’t rushed through your sessions. We listen and respond appropriately. You are guided to a place where healing will begin from within.”
